If the tumour is affecting all of the maxilla the whole bone is removed. This is a total maxillectomy. If your cancer has spread into all the walls and also into nearby structures you will need to have a radical maxillectomy.

Stages of Paranasal Sinus and Nasal Cavity Cancers ... Staging is the process of finding out if and how far a cancer has spread. The stage of a cancer is one of the most important factors in choosing treatment options and predicting your chance for cure and long-term survival.
